Scope and content

Photocopy of The Mighty Eighth Air Force Heritage Museum, Savannah, appeal leaflet. Photocopies of photographs of John Rex and reprints of photographs of Military Police colleagues. Letter from John Rex to Anne Hoare recalling his Military Police career and hospital memories, c. 1989 (7 pages). Typescript recollections of the 987th Military Police Co. by John Rex, 1990 (2 pages). Photocopies of news cuttings relating to John Rex's return visit to Norwich, c. 1985.
